Web1. (Furniture) a folding chair for use out of doors, consisting of a wooden frame suspending a length of canvas. 2. rearranging the deckchairs on the Titanic jocular engaged in futile or ineffectual actions. Webmove (the) deckchairs on the Titanic To partake in or undertake some task, activity, or course of action that will ultimately prove trivial or futile in its possible effect or outcome. Primarily heard in UK, Australia. WebThe Titanic would have had thousands of deck chairs, and they washed off the deck. They [the rescue ships] probably picked up 20 to 30 deck chairs. That small number narrows down to a handful today. The Titanic did not have its own specific, distinctive deck chair. What you’re doing is as useful as rearranging? “What you’re doing is as ...
